    Abstract: A device may include a processor system and an array of data processing engines (DPEs) communicatively coupled to the processor system. Each of the DPEs includes a core and a DPE interconnect. The processor system is configured to transmit configuration data to the array of DPEs, and each of the DPEs is independently configurable based on the configuration data received at the respective DPE via the DPE interconnect of the respective DPE. The array of DPEs enable, without modifying operation of a first kernel of a first subset of the DPEs of the array of DPEs, reconfiguration of a second subset of the DPEs of the array of DPEs.

    Abstract: Examples herein describe performing non-sequential DMA read and writes. Rather than storing data sequentially, a DMA engine can write data into memory using non-sequential memory addresses. A data processing engine (DPE) controller can submit a first job using first parameters that instruct the DMA engine to store data using a first non-sequential write pattern. The DPE controller can also submit a second job using second parameters that instruct the DMA engine to store data using a second, different non-sequential write pattern. In this manner, the DMA engine can switch to performing DMA writes using different non-sequential patterns. Similarly, the DMA engine can use non-sequential reads to retrieve data from memory. When performing a first DMA read, the DMA engine can retrieve data from memory using a first sequential pattern and then perform a second DMA read where data is retrieved from memory using a second non-sequential read pattern.

    Abstract: An integrated circuit includes a plurality of data processing engines (DPEs) DPEs. Each DPE may include a core configured to perform computations. A first DPE of the plurality of DPEs includes a first core coupled to an input cascade connection of the first core. The input cascade connection is directly coupled to a plurality of source cores of the plurality of DPEs. The input cascade connection includes a plurality of inputs, wherein each of the plurality of inputs is connected to a cascade output of a different one of the plurality of source cores. The input cascade connection is programmable to enable a selected one of the plurality of inputs.

    Abstract: An example data processing engine (DPE) for a DPE array in an integrated circuit (IC) includes: a core; a memory including a data memory and a program memory, the program memory coupled to the core, the data memory coupled to the core and including at least one connection to a respective at least one additional core external to the DPE; support circuitry including hardware synchronization circuitry and direct memory access (DMA) circuitry each coupled to the data memory; streaming interconnect coupled to the DMA circuitry and the core; and memory-mapped interconnect coupled to the core, the memory, and the support circuitry.

    Abstract: An integrated circuit can include a data processing engine (DPE) array having a plurality of tiles. The plurality of tiles can include a plurality of DPE tiles, wherein each DPE tile includes a stream switch, a core configured to perform operations, and a memory module. The plurality of tiles can include a plurality of memory tiles, wherein each memory tile includes a stream switch, a direct memory access (DMA) engine, and a random-access memory. The DMA engine of each memory tile may be configured to access the random-access memory within the same memory tile and the random-access memory of at least one other memory tile. Selected ones of the plurality of DPE tiles may be configured to access selected ones of the plurality of memory tiles via the stream switches.

    Abstract: Techniques related to a data processing engine for an integrated circuit (IC) are described. In an example, a method is provided for vectorized peak detection. The method includes dividing a set of data samples of a data signal, corresponding to a peak detection window (PDW), into a plurality of subsets of data samples each comprising a number of data samples. The method includes performing vector operations on each of the plurality of subsets of data samples. The method includes determining a running index of a sample with a maximum amplitude over the PDW based on the vector operations.
